#d85151 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d85151 is composed of 84.7% red, 31.8%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.5% magenta, 62.5%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 58.2%. #d85151 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2a2 with #b10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d85151 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d85151 has RGB values of R:216, G:81,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.63,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14176593.

Shades and Tints of #d85151
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d85151
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969393 is the less saturated color, while #f93030 is the most saturated one.
